Use the save as html on the file list, then choose (during the wizard) asp format for your forms, what happens now is that your form will have the name "yourform_alx1.asp" and "yourform_1.asp", two files for your one form. you will need to use the yourform_1.asp as the file to view and this asp file looks to the yourform_alx1.asp for the content of the form.
